I had the Leon for one of my hamsters.He seemed to really like it.He seemed to enjoy using the different levels & you can make each level so different.
Dont forget to plastikote the shelves though.
Mines stored away at the moment as my hammy died of old age & when I got a new addition, someone on my local facebook buy & sell page was selling an almost new Alexander for a bargain price which I couldnt resist!
But Im sure I will use my Leon again at some point

Also, one point....my Syrian hamster was quite small in size so Im wondering if this cage may be slightly too small for a larger hammy?
